Bimaximal neutrino mixing in a Zee-type model with badly broken flavor symmetry
2001
Physical Review D, Particles and fields
A Zee-type neutrino mass matrix model with a badly broken horizontal symmetry SU(3)_H is investigated. By putting a simple ansatz on the symmetry breaking effects of SU(3)_H for transition matrix elements, it is demonstrated that the model can give a nearly bimaximal neutrino mixing with the ratio Δ m^2_solar/Δ m^2_atm≃√(2) m_e/m_μ=6.7 × 10^-3, which are in excellent agreement with the observed data. In the near future, the lepton-number violating decay Z→μ^±τ^∓ will be observed.
